Job description

Location: Boise, ID/Spokane, WA | Field-Based

Reports to: Regional Sales Manager

Employment Type: Full-time

Seniority Level: Mid-Senior Level

Industry: Manufacturing | Industrial Machinery | Power Transmission

Job Function: Sales | Engineering | Customer Support

Job Summary: The Field Sales Engineer is responsible for managing and growing sales within a defined territory by acting as a strategic partner to customers, distributors, and internal stakeholders. This role serves as a primary point of contact for technical sales of Dodge products and solutions, driving volume growth and capturing new business opportunities through field engagement and relationship development.

This role requires a blend of technical expertise, sales acumen, and customer focus to identify and convert opportunities, support channel partners, and build long-term relationships in the power transmission industry.

Key Responsibilities:
Sales Strategy & Growth
  • Develop and execute territory sales plans aligned with company objectives.
  • Identify new business opportunities and support conversions to Dodge products through plant surveys and customer interaction.
  • Achieve year-over-year sales growth by increasing volume and expanding into new accounts.
Customer & Channel Engagement
  • Build strong relationships with distributor partners and end users.
  • Conduct regular branch and customer site visits to maintain visibility and support local sales efforts.
  • Serve as a trusted advisor and technical resource to customers.
Technical Support & Product Application
  • Provide product recommendations and interchange solutions based on plant surveys and application analysis.
  • Collaborate with product marketing, engineering, and inside sales teams to support customer needs.
  • Communicate product advantages and ensure customer satisfaction through consultative selling.
Collaboration & Territory Management
  • Work closely with the Regional Sales Manager and other Sales Engineers to share best practices and align efforts.
  • Develop and execute joint business plans with key distributor and customer contacts.
  • Engage with cross-functional teams to leverage resources and close strategic opportunities.
  • Submit accurate sales reports and expense documentation in a timely manner.
  • Use Salesforce, Power BI, and other tools to track performance, forecast opportunities, and analyze sales trends.
Qualifications:
  • Bachelor’s degree (technical field preferred) or equivalent relevant experience.
  • 2–3 years of experience in the power transmission or industrial equipment industry.
  • 1–2 years of Dodge product knowledge preferred.
  • Excellent verbal, written, and interpersonal communication skills.
  • Strong organizational skills with the ability to manage multiple accounts and priorities.
  • Self‑starter with the ability to work independently with minimal supervision.
  • Proficiency with CRM systems and sales reporting tools (Salesforce preferred).
Physical Requirements:
  • Ability to walk long distances in industrial environments, including extreme heat, dust, heights, and confined spaces.
  • Comfortable with climbing structures, walking catwalks, and accessing tight areas.
  • Ability to lift and pull up to 50 lbs.
  • Must be able to drive for extended periods.
  • Ability to travel frequently within the territory.
  • Comfortable presenting in-person and virtually to individuals and small groups.
